The Late Bridie Collins, nee Riordan, Abbeyfeale and Knocknagoshel

The Late Bridie Collins, nee Riordan, Knocknagoshel and Abbeyfeale pictured with her 1957 MG at the annual Knockdown Vintage Rally in July 2012. ©Photograph: John Reidy 15-7-2012

The death has occurred of Bridie Collins, nee Riordan, 2, Tara, Mountmahon, Abbeyfeale, Co. Limerick and formerly of Kilmanihan West, Knocknagoshel, Co. Kerry.

Bridie passed away peacefully on March 20th. 2019 at Milford Care Centre.

Bridie is very sadly missed by her loving children Gerard and Sheila, husband Billy, brothers John, Mike and Pa, sister Peg, son-in-law Liam, daughter-in-law Zabrina, grandchildren Navarra, Jamie, Jack and Seánie, brothers-in-law, sisters-in-law, nephews, nieces, cousins, neighbours and a large circle of friends. Rest In Peace.

Funeral Arrangements

Reposing at Harnett’s Funeral Home, The Square, Abbeyfeale on Friday from 6.00 p.m. followed by removal at 8pm. to the Church of The Assumption Abbeyfeale.

Requiem Mass on Saturday at 11am. followed by private cremation.

No flowers please. Donations if desired to Milford Care Centre.
